摘要:In the Wireless Sensor Network (WSN), nodes are used to observe the surroundings like temperature,
humidity, pressure, position, vibration, sound etc. The Quality-of-Service (QoS) is an important issue in order to ensure
its effectiveness and robustness. Besides its undoubtedly services and contributions in monitoring systems, WSN’s
limited resources can severely degrade the QoS in applications. Congestion in WSN will further reduce the expected
QoS of the associated applications. In this case, efficient use of the scarce resources is important to ensure seamless
data transmission. The power consumption of a sensor node can be reduced by reducing the rate of packet
retransmission which is caused by congestion. In this paper, a selective packet discarding method which is known as
Packet Discarding based Node Clustering (PDNC) is introduced. All nodes deployed in the targeted area will be
clustered into several groups and a cluster head will be selected at a time. The packet discarding process will then be
carried at each node to reduce the number of packets contributing to congestion.
